Colour

Colour is crucial to how customers perceive a space. It is the visual carrier of information, and it directly affects how customers feel as they navigate the area.

For example, a space with red walls and a red merchandise display cabinet might make the customer feel warm and comfortable. In contrast, a space with green walls and the same red cabinet might induce feelings of calmness and serenity. The customer’s perception of the area is directly linked to their emotional response.

Colour can create visual hierarchy, create distinguishability among various product categories, and create a sense of style and identity for the space.
The right colour can also help draw in customers, who will subconsciously associate the color with the products inside the store.

Giclee Fine Art Printing

The French word “gicler” means to spray or squirt, which gives you an instant insight into the principle behind Giclée printing. This is an advanced digital printing technique, most commonly used to create fine art prints and high-resolution photographs due to its superior quality compared to alternative methods.

The process requires some top-of-the-range photo printing equipment. For example, commercial Giclée printing will often be done using something like an Epson 9880 or 9900 printer, along with Epson Ultrachrome K3 inks which are designed to produce extremely accurate and realistic colours. These kinds of printers would typically be able to create prints measuring around 40 inches across, or even much larger in some cases.

The purpose of using this specialised equipment is to ensure that prints are as true to the original image as possible, something which is vital when reproducing fine art photographs, for example. When colours have to be captured perfectly and high levels of digital detail need to be preserved down to the last pixel, Giclée printing is usually the ideal choice. The print heads in these printers usually contain at least eight separate ink channels, allowing for a much greater depth of colour and range of tones compared to standard printing methods.

Benefits of Graphic Design on Business

What is graphic design? Graphic designs are designs that are used for marketing purposes. These include logos, business cards, brochures, banners, leaflets and much more. These are also used and extended on other platforms such as websites, social media and mobile apps. The primary purpose of graphic design is to help businesses communicate their brand to their customers through visual designs to convert them to sales. Below is a list of benefits of using graphic design for businesses.

First Impression

One of the main benefits of using strong graphic design for your business is that you’re more likely to give an excellent first impression to your customers. Designs can help make your business look presentable in the eyes of your customers. We all know that first impressions count!

Stand Out

Graphic design reflects your brand identity in a creative and unique way. When you have your own brand identity you’re more likely to stand out. In business, standing out is what will set you apart from the competition.

Using Lighting To Create An Atmosphere In Retail

Lighting is an often-underrated aspect of the complete retail experience that retailers would do well to consider more often. It’s all part of the physical factors that influence the look and feel of a shop. These directly feed into the minds of your potential customers, whether you or they realise it or not. Even if you haven’t planned it, and the customer doesn’t know it’s happening, you’re sending a message that’s either encouraging them to make a purchase or putting them off. This is why it’s vital to be in control when it comes to lighting.
